Flybe Seeks Access To London Military Airport

LONDON—British regional airline Flybe is seeking permission from the U.K. government to operate commercial flights at Northolt, a military airfield in western London. Flybe CEO Saad Hammad says RAF Northolt is an “underused national asset” that could be opened up to allow 300,000 passengers a year...
